Elephant Blocks Road In Odisha, Passengers Stranded

Bhawanipatna: Panic gripped the passengers of a state-run bus after an elephant blocked the road for nearly two hours in Karlapat forest area in Kalahandi district on Tuesday.

According to reports, the Odisha State Road Transport Corporation (OSRTC) bus with 40 passengers was going to Rampur from Bhawanipatna in the morning when the driver suddenly stopped the vehicle after spotting the elephant on the road.

The elephant remained on the road for around two hours and then went inside the forest.

“Usually elephants move along in the Karlapat forest area at night. But villagers living in the forest periphery are panicked to find this elephant moving during the day,” said a resident of Karlapat.

Notably, the Forest Department has declared Karlapat forest as one of the elephant corridors in Odisha.
